New San Francisco flight will boost Silicon Valley connections to Ireland

It is announced by Aer Lingus that a new direct air route between Dublin and San Francisco will be introduced which will fly five times a week starting on Wednesday April 2nd.  Currently approximately 40 percent of the foreign direct investment to Ireland from the US comes from the Silicon Valley area.  Major technology companies, such as LinkedIn and Google have their international headquarters in Dublin while their founding HQs are in the San Francisco area, no doubt this new direct air route will boost Ireland’s profile and visibility as a business location in the Silicon Valley region.

The BA (Hons) Marketing (Event Management)  provides students with the key skills to plan and execute successful events. Tackling logistical, financial, operational and communications challenges, the programme was developed to provide a structured approach to planning and managing events that reduce pressure on the event organiser and produce a top quality event.
